M’sian Arrested for Using a Parang to Vandalise Traffic Lights in Broad Daylight at Port Dickson

A recent video shared by @update11111 that has been making rounds online shows a man vandalising a traffic light in Port Dickson.

In response, the Port Dickson District Police released a statement on their Facebook page after being alerted to the 33-second clip, which captures the local man damaging the traffic light cover using a machete.

He was vandalising multiple traffic light covers

The statement says the incident happened on October 20th at 2:15 PM at a traffic light intersection from Kampung Arab, Shell Gate, heading to Kampung Gelam, Port Dickson, NSDK.

Acting on information received, the Criminal Investigation Division of the Port Dickson Police arrested the suspect the same day at approximately 4:45 PM in a hut near Seaview Beach, Port Dickson.

The suspect is unemployed with prior criminal records

The suspect, a 39-year-old man who’s unemployed and has 2 previous criminal records, tested negative for drugs. The police also took the weapon, vehicle, and clothes he used during the incident.

He is scheduled to appear in the Port Dickson Magistrate’s Court for a remand hearing tomorrow. The case is currently being investigated under Section 427 of the Criminal Code and Section 6(1) of the Dangerous Corrosive Substances and Explosive Weapons Act (ABKLSB) 1958.

Authorities are advising the public not to spread this issue online, as it could cause unnecessary concern among others.
